Book Synopsis
Winner of the Independent Foreign Fiction Prize for the best translated novel of 2014, now a New Directions paperback

Trade Review
"Words and stories and memory are the vehicle by which the reader moves, intoxicatingly and fearlessly, through a dizzying but magnificent series of terrains." -- Michele Filgate - The Boston Globe
"Wonderful, elegant and exhilarating, ferocious as well as virtuosic: The End of Days is her most direct address to history." -- Deborah Eisenberg - The New York Review of Books
"One of the finest, most exciting authors alive." -- Michael Faber
"Dreamlike, almost incantatory prose." -- Vogue
"Beautiful and ambitious. Erpenbeck’s graceful prose suits the understated tone of this Hans Fallada Prize winner." -- Publishers Weekly, (starred review)
"The brutality of her subjects, combined with the fierce intelligence and tenderness at work behind her restrained, unvarnished prose, is overwhelming." -- Nicole Krauss
